g++ version 4.3.6 and older, when encoutering a constant literal
  0xffffffffffffffff
gives an error
  error: integer constant is too large for ‘long’ type

For example, on Fedora 1 with g++ 3.3.2, we get this error:

This patch fixes it.


2024-09-16  Bruno Haible  <br...@clisp.org>

        stdc_count_ones: Fix compilation error with g++ < 4.4.
        * lib/stdbit.in.h (__gl_stdbit_popcount_wide): Suffix 64-bit integer
        constant with LL.
